What color is 4B408E?

The RGB color code for color number #4B408E is RGB(75, 64, 142). In the RGB color model, #4B408E has a red value of 75, a green value of 64, and a blue value of 142.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 47.2% cyan, 54.9% magenta, 0.0% yellow, and 44.3%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 248.5° (degrees), 37.9 % saturation, and 40.4 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#4B408E has a hue of 248.5° (degrees), 54.9 % saturation and 55.7 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of 4B408E?

Color code 4B408E has an LRV of nearly 7. By LRV value, it is a dark color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.

Triadic Color Palette

The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el

Tetradic Color Palette

The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
